TL;DR Summary

Johnson & Johnson has ended development of its adult RSV vaccine in the middle of a 27,200-patient trial, citing a shifting competitive landscape. Emergent BioSolutions' Narcan brand naloxone nasal spray has been approved by the FDA for over-the-counter sales. AstraZeneca has scrapped its license agreement with Aridis Pharmaceuticals, putting a European-funded Phase III trial on hold.
